Transaction 68723f6424dfe5f5d96176b89520a22213beefe1997b2ad07a94aaad291b18e0
1 Input
1 Output
-
68723f6424dfe5f5d96176b89520a22213beefe1997b2ad07a94aaad291b18e0:0
- value
- 1087907
- script pubkey
- OP_0 OP_PUSHBYTES_20 76818ebe2e49edbc293b2ae97105508d66eced16
- address
- bc1qw6qca03wf8kmc2fm9t5hzp2s34nwemgkq0gpgl